The Martynov-Sarkisov-Vompe (MSV) (1999) (Eq. 33 Ref. 1) closure is given in terms of the bridge function

where

where is short-ranged. The WCA division of the Lennard-Jones potential was used. (Notice that the Martynov-Sarkisov-Vompe closure, for a hard sphere fluid, becomes the Martynov Sarkisov closure).
